Bazooka Burgers by Meows Trap Seeds

Unknown

Bazooka Burgers is an indica-dominant strain meticulously developed by Meows Trap Seeds. It honors classic comfort food culture with an explosive twist, combining robust genetics with enhanced flavor and potency. This strain has gained popularity for its dependable effects and unique sensory experience.

Appearance

Bazooka Burgers presents dense, compact buds characteristic of its indica heritage. These nugs are covered in a thick layer of trichomes, suggesting significant cannabinoid content. The visual appeal is enhanced by a deep green coloration contrasted with bright orange pistils.

The robust bud structure is indicative of high resin production, making it suitable for concentrate extraction. Cultivators often note the substantial size and density of the buds, which contribute to its yield potential.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ma of Bazooka Burgers is notably complex, beginning with a strong, pungent diesel scent. This is complemented by undertones of toasted herbs and savory, almost burger-like notes, creating a unique olfactory profile. The intensity of its aroma is rated highly by sensory panels.

Its flavor mirrors the aroma, offering an earthy base with spicy, tangy notes on the inhale. Consumers can expect a smooth transition through skunky undertones, diesel, and toasted herbs, often finishing with hints of sweet, caramelized sugar and a mild peppery finish.

Effects

Bazooka Burgers is recognized for delivering calming and euphoric effects, consistent with its indica lineage. Users often report a sense of tranquility and upliftment, making it a popular choice for relaxation.

The strain's psychoactive properties are primarily cerebral, offering a pleasant mental experience without being overly sedating for most users. Its balanced profile contributes to its reputation for dependable and enjoyable effects.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

Laboratory analysis indicates Bazooka Burgers typically contains THC levels ranging from 18% to 24%. Its indica dominance is reflected in its cannabinoid profile, which also includes moderate CBD content, usually between 0.5% and 1.0%. Trace amounts of other cannabinoids like CBG and CBC are also present.

The terpene profile is characterized by the prominent presence of Myrcene and Caryophyllene. These terpenes contribute significantly to the strain's distinctive aroma and flavor notes, as well as its overall effects.

Growing

Bazooka Burgers is noted for its genetic stability and ease of propagation, making it a reliable choice for cultivators. It exhibits consistent yield potential and performs predictably across various growing environments.

The strain's indica-dominant genetics contribute to predictable growth patterns. It is known for producing higher-than-average resin yields, which is beneficial for both flower production and extract creation.

Origins & Lineage

Developed by Meows Trap Seeds, Bazooka Burgers was bred to blend modern cannabis breeding innovation with traditional indica traits. The strain aims to evoke a connection to comfort food culture with a unique explosive twist.

While specific parental lineage details are proprietary, Bazooka Burgers is understood to be approximately 80% indica dominant. Its genetics are selected for consistency, robust indica characteristics, high resin production, and calming effects.
